You may consider doing COVID-19 testing ahead of time as another level of precaution before holiday gatherings. If possible, taking an at-home rapid COVID-19 test the day of the event is ideal. While these tests aren’t 100% accurate, a negative result strongly suggests that you’re not contagious at that particular time.

Dec 30, 2021·Rapid COVID tests not as accurate with Omicron: U.S. regulator. Rapid COVID home tests are more likely to give a false negative with the heavily-mutated Omicron variant compared to earlier strains, the U.S. Food and Drug Administration (FDA) says.
